Model Overview

The ishikauniphore/student_generator_Qwen2 is a substantial language model, featuring 14.8 billion parameters and a 32768-token context length. It is built upon the Qwen2 architecture, indicating a foundation designed for strong performance in various language understanding and generation tasks.

Key Capabilities

  • General Text Generation: Capable of producing diverse and coherent text based on given prompts.
  • Large Context Window: The 32768-token context length allows for processing and generating longer, more complex sequences of text, maintaining context over extended interactions.
  • Qwen2 Architecture: Benefits from the underlying architectural advancements of the Qwen2 family, which typically includes optimizations for efficiency and performance.

Limitations

As with many large language models, users should be aware of potential biases present in the training data and the possibility of generating inaccurate or nonsensical information. Specific details regarding training data, evaluation metrics, and known biases are not provided in the current model card, suggesting further investigation or cautious deployment is advisable.
